Medical Machining and Metalmite

Metalmite has been looking into the medical machining field for some time now. CNC machining is the process used to manufacture different types of medical tools such as scissors, clamps, surgical knives, syringes, and others. Medical instruments manufacturing uses advanced machining processes that help in producing precision medical tools and equipment required in the medical industry.

Medical machining involves the machining of metal parts, which are extremely intricate and are mainly made from special alloys, stainless, or titanium. Different techniques used in medical machining include 5 axis milling, 6 axis machining, wire edm, and electro etching. Chemical etching machining process is mainly used for producing typical precision medical parts. The medical industry has very strict guidelines and regulations for how clean the environment must be as well as quality documentation. Many of the medical products must first be proven out with a working prototype and then followed up with the small volume production run. This is where Metalmite is able to excel on both sides of the spectrum.

  The need for medical machining ranges from contract precision manufacturing of implants and surgical instruments
to cardio/neuro stimulation, orthopedic, interventional, and drug delivery. As well as Prototyping leading to volume production and cleanroom, packaging, and labeling requirements. The minimum quality rating are ISO 13485 and ISO 9001 registered firms.

CNC Screw Machine

Complex part made by 6 axis CNC lathe

Complex part made by 6 axis CNC lathe

Through the years the term “screw machine” and “CNC machine” or “CNC lathe” have been interchangeable. In recent years however the term CNC machining has become much more relevant to the end user. Our small prototype machine shop has even gone as far as to use 6 axis CNC turning centers made by Mori Seiki, the NL-2500 is our flagship multi-tool lathe. These new CNC lathes can not only turn in two chuck’s, but they can mill and drill from all sides as well!  If you look at the picture on the left you will see how a part could be made from solid at one time. This is a tremendous cost savings and time savings for the customer.  What typically took 3-4 weeks and 3 or 4 operations is now done in two weeks and in one operation. So when someone calls us and asks if we are a screw machining shop we always repond with a firmative and ask to see the part they want made.  Keep in mind the terms CNC machine shop, CNC machining, and 6 axis machining can all be interchangeable these days.  It is far better to descibe the part you would like completed rather than ask what kind of equipment the supplier has.

Saving Time and Money for our Customers

LarryBinkowskiphotoMetalmite has worked very hard to save time and money for their customers over the years. Everything from adding 5 axis machining to CNC screw machining centers that have decreased our leadtime by half.  On this job in the picture we have manufactured these aluminum plates for over 10 years. The original setup was on 3 seperate CNC Machining centers with 3 serperate operator’s. After a few years of having the job repeat, we were able to maximize our CNC Manufacturing procedure’s. We currently use one CNC Machining center and have 3 separate clamp systems that hold the the part through the 3 separate operations. As a one stop machine shop we work hard to save time and money for our customers. We have used several methods learned from our high speed milling techniques that have further increased our efficiency as well. The part has decreased in cost by 50% to our customer and they are thrilled with the results during these trying times.  Metalmite works hard to offer World Class Quality, Service, and Delivery at the RIGHT Price!

Metalmite is “Going Green”

Tom Gendich & the SMART Car

Tom Gendich & the SMART Car

I must admit that “Going Green” has become a buzz word today that I am not sure I completely understand. For years in manufacturing we have been discussing “becoming lean”, and the strategies of lean manufacturing. We have Six Sigma seminar’s and discussions about lean work cell’s. We look to cut costs by reducing extra processes and cutting out “non-value added” procedures. Metalmite has achieved these things by using 5 axis and 6 axis machining cells. But now we have this new philosophy about “Going Green” and becoming “Green Certified”. These two philosophies are in direct competition with one another. One is about saving money at any cost, and the other is about saving the planet at any cost. I recently received this e-mail from a company offering us a certificate for being “Green Certified”. They said simply complete “a self-certification program that allows you to describe how your business provides a green product or service, or uses a green manufacturing process. When you register, you will answer a series of questions about the green activities your business participates in. Those answers will appear on your certification page along with other business information.”

They are offering me a certificate for $189 per year that says I am “Green Certified”. Does that mean that I am now recycling my pop cans? Or that we will contact the proper disposal companies for old laptop batteries? Well we do both of these things at Metalmite now. I think the concept is that we will be more conscience of the environment and more protective of our natural setting. We like that idea and have lived by that principal all of our lives. There is a concern though that individuals and companies are missing the main point. It is not about having a green leaf on the side of your SUV, or about having a certificate that says you are “Green Certified”, but rather a commitment to protect our world and our environment. We love the idea of “Alternative Energy” and finding ways to use Windmill power and Electric Vehicles. We are on the vendor list for Tesla Motors, I have been in contact with executive management at Aptera Motors, and we have manufactured parts for the GM Volt.  As seen in the picture attached, Metalmite supports the SMART car as well. At SMART Car, System partners on site deliver the prefabricated modules directly to the production line. Protecting the environment, energy efficiency and preservation of natural resources are hallmarks of smart brand. It starts with smart development through to the production of the cars in smartville. The smart fortwo is also classified as an Ultra-Low Emission Vehicle (ULEV) due to its extremely low exhaust emissions. Metalmite is extremely interested in the future of these vehicles and what part we may play in their success.  We have added Wire EDM to our list of services, which offers very little waste or by-products in the process of cutting materials. We continue to be “lean” in our thinking and with our price’s, but we are also “green” in our concern for the environment and in our philosophy of manufacturing. Although I am not sure we will be “certified” anytime soon, we can give you our word that we are thinking and acting “green” in every way we can.

Metalmite works with Titanium

Titanium Part

Titanium Part

Recently a military vehicle manufacturer came to Metalmite and asked them to make some idler shafts out of 6Al-4V Titanium instead of the 8620 steel alloy they were originally designed out of. The ATI Ti-6Al-4V Alloy (UNS 56400) is the most widely used titanium grade. It is a two phase α+β titanium alloy, with aluminum as the alpha stabilizer and vanadium as the beta stabilizer. This high-strength alloy can be used at cryogenic temperatures to about 800° F (427°C). ATI Ti-6Al-4V alloy is used in the annealed condition and in the solution treated and aged condition. Some applications include: compressor blades, discs, and rings for jet engines; airframe and space capsule components; pressure vessels; rocket engine cases; helicopter rotor hubs; fasteners; critical forgings requiring high strength-to-weight ratios. This alloy is produced by primary melting using vacuum arc (VAR), electron beam (EB), or plasma arc hearth melting (PAM). Remelting is achieved by one or two vacuum arc steps.
Metalmite found that the machining was not as difficult as they were originally told, it must be turned slower and not pushed like the steel alloys. The finish came out very clean and smooth. The parts were turned in the Mori Seiki lathe and inspected on the CMM afterwards to verify that they were right to spec. Another CNC Machining job well done by Metalmite.
